How are assisted living facilities in Danvers regulated and licensed?

Assisted living facilities in Danvers, IL, are regulated and licensed by the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) under the Assisted Living and Shared Housing Establishment Act. This ensures compliance with state standards for safety, staffing, and care. Facilities must undergo regular inspections, and families can review inspection reports through the IDPH website to make informed decisions about care options in Danvers.

Navigating Medicare Assisted Living Options in Danvers, IL

Navigating senior care options in Danvers can feel overwhelming, especially when trying to understand how Medicare fits into the picture for assisted living. It’s a common starting point for many families, and it’s important to have clear, compassionate guidance. First, let’s address the central question directly: Original Medicare (Part A and Part B) does not pay for long-term custodial care in an assisted living facility. This often comes as a surprise and can add financial stress to an already emotional decision-making process. Medicare is primarily designed for short-term medical needs, like hospital stays, doctor visits, and rehabilitative therapy. Understanding this distinction is the crucial first step in planning.

However, this doesn’t mean Medicare is irrelevant to Danvers seniors considering assisted living. If a resident requires skilled nursing care or physical therapy for a recovery period, Medicare may cover those specific services even while they live in an assisted living community, provided the care is ordered by a doctor and delivered by a Medicare-certified provider. This is often a temporary benefit. For the ongoing personal care, meal preparation, medication management, and housing that define assisted living, families typically rely on private funds, long-term care insurance, or, for those who qualify, Medicaid. In Illinois, the Medicaid program has specific waivers that can help with assisted living costs, but eligibility and availability have strict limits.

For families in Danvers, this means creating a holistic financial plan is essential. Begin by having an open conversation with your loved one about their resources, including savings, pensions, and any existing insurance policies. Consulting with a local elder law attorney or a certified financial planner who understands Illinois regulations can provide invaluable direction. They can help explore options like Veterans Aid & Attendance benefits for qualified veterans or provide clarity on the complex Medicaid landscape in our state. The McLean County area, which includes Danvers, has resources like the East Central Illinois Area Agency on Aging that can offer free counseling and help navigate these public benefits.
